1. Types of Ovens
When it concerns ovens, there is no one-size-fits-all solution. Comprehending the different types of ovens is necessary to making the best choice for your cooking requires.
| Type of Oven | Description |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| Traditional Ovens | The most typical type, featuring heating aspects at the top and bottom. | General baking and roasting. |
| Convection Ovens | Uses a fan to distribute hot air for even cooking. | Baking, roasting, and reheating. |
| Microwave Ovens | Cooks food utilizing electro-magnetic radiation. | Quick cooking and reheating. |
| Wall Ovens | Built into the wall for space-saving and aesthetic appeal. | Modern kitchens and convenience. |
| Double Ovens | Two separate oven compartments for simultaneous cooking. | Big households and multi-course meals. |
| Steam Ovens | Utilizes steam to cook food, keeping wetness and nutrients. | Healthy cooking and baking. |
2. Secret Features to Consider
When examining different ovens online, it's essential to think about the functions that will best satisfy your culinary requirements. Below is a list of functions to keep in mind:
- Size: Ensure the oven fits your cooking area space. Inspect dimensions and internal capability.
- Energy Efficiency: Look for ovens with an Energy Star ranking to save money on electrical power expenses.
- Smart Features: Some ovens provide Wi-Fi connectivity for remote control and monitoring.
- Self-Cleaning: A practical option for simple maintenance.
- Temperature Controls: Look for ovens with accurate temperature level control for much better cooking results.
- Multiple Cooking Modes: Ovens with various settings (e.g., baking, broiling, air frying) provide versatility.

4. Tips for Buying Ovens Online
Here are some useful pointers to guide you through the online oven purchasing procedure:
Research Brands and Models: Look for trusted brand names known for quality and reliability. Client reviews can use important insights into real-world performance.
Read the Specifications Carefully: Ensure that the oven satisfies your cooking needs by examining its functions and abilities.
Check Size Compatibility: Measure your kitchen space and compare it with the oven's dimensions noted online to make sure a great fit.
Understand Return Policies: Familiarize yourself with the seller's return and exchange policies in case the oven does not fulfill your expectations.
Try To Find Warranty Information: Ensure that the oven includes a guarantee that covers parts and labor for an affordable period.
Use Filters: Many online sellers provide filters that permit you to narrow down your choices based on your particular criteria (e.g., price, type, functions).

5.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Is it safe to buy home appliances online?
Yes, buying appliances online is typically safe, provided you acquire from reliable sellers. Look for widely known brands and inspect client evaluations.
2. What are the delivery alternatives for ovens?
Delivery alternatives differ by merchant however typically include basic shipment, which may take a few days, and expedited shipment for quicker arrival times.
3. Can I return an oven if it does not fit my kitchen?
Many retailers have return policies that enable returns or exchanges within a particular period, generally 30 to 60 days, as long as the item remains in its original condition.
4. How do I understand if the oven will fit my kitchen area?
Step your available space thoroughly and compare it with the item dimensions listed on the retailer's website. It's likewise great to inspect for clearance space around the oven.
5. Do I need to work with a professional for installation?
While some ovens can be set up by property owners, others, especially integrated designs or gas ovens, might require expert setup. Constantly examine the maker's installation standards.
